Gasoline samples are gathered by bubbling them via a trap that contains a suitable solvent. Organic and natural isocyanates in industrial atmospheres are gathered by bubbling the air by means of an answer of one-(2-methoxyphenyl)piperazine in toluene. The reaction amongst the isocyanates and one-(two-methoxyphenyl)piperazine the two stabilizes high performance liquid chromatography principle them versus degradation before the HPLC Evaluation and converts them to your chemical form that could be monitored by UV absorption.

The schematic of an HPLC instrument typically features solvents' reservoirs, a number of pumps, a solvent-degasser, a sampler, a column, plus a detector. The solvents are ready in advance in more info accordance with the demands in the separation, they pass through the degasser to get rid of dissolved gasses, mixed to be the mobile section, then circulation through the sampler, which provides the sample mixture into the cellular phase stream, which then carries it in the column. The pumps deliver the specified movement and composition of your cellular stage in the stationary section Within the column, then directly into a movement-mobile In the detector.
